About

Alta

Alta Planning + Design is a sustainable transportation company dedicated to creating active, healthy communities through planning, landscape architecture, engineering, and education/encouragement programs. Founded in 1996, Alta pioneered the field of active transportation, evolving its planning and design work into a visionary global practice that empowers people to live active, healthy lives and get them to where they need to go.

Our core values and work bring about positive change by creating places that are geared toward moving people rather than cars, connecting community members to daily needs and human experience, and empowering every person to live an active healthy life. As a global leader in mobility innovation for over 27 years with over 230 staff, we are dedicated to connecting people to places by working across disciplines and scale to address social justice, safety, and environmental resilience.

Day

to Day

Our Senior Civil Engineering PM will be involved in helping foster livable communities in all parts of the country. Projects range from natural surface trails to large arterial multi-use paths; from Complete Streets to regional/multi-state bicycle and trail networks.

Responsibilities
  • Managing a variety of transportation projects from design through construction, driving project success and influencing sustainable outcomes.
  • Implementing best practices and process improvements to enhance project delivery efficiency and effectiveness.
  • Mentoring staff and contributing to internal professional development and training for the technical engineering team.
  • Providing leadership and technical expertise to the Engineering team and collaborating with other disciplines (planning, landscape, data) as needed.
  • Preparing schedules, budgets, and scopes of services for projects.
  • Balancing workloads across projects.
  • Supporting the regional leader in business development.
